I know that Costco, BJ's, Sam's Club can have some good buys, but I think a savvy shopper can get just as good (or better) deals at their local supermarkets by watching for sales, using coupons and being less brand loyal.
A few times over the years, we've gotten free memberships to one of the warehouse stores. We've gone and made a list of the items we buy regularly and compared prices with the supermarket. Sometimes the warehouse place was cheaper, but not when the supermarket had a sale or we had a coupon. Also, at the supermarket we can pick the store brand which is a lot cheaper than the brand name no matter where you buy it. So you really need to do your homework before paying a fee to join the warehouse place. You may discover that it really isn't worth it.
